If you want to grow your own seeds, sow them in spring or early summer. However, germination is quite slow. Plant the seedlings in early fall when they are about 10 cm in size. Leave a space of about 50 cm between plants to allow for air circulation.

Web10 apr. 2024 · How to Grow. Lavender requires a full sun location in well-draining soil with a neutral to slightly alkaline pH of 6.5 to 8.0. Photo by Lorna Kring.
